Dรฉtails du cours
โข Introduction to Smart Systems: Understanding the basics of smart systems, their components, and how they can be integrated into biomedical applications.
โข Artificial Intelligence (AI) in Healthcare: Exploring the role of AI in healthcare, including the opportunities and challenges it presents for biomedical applications.
โข Data Analytics for Biomedical Applications: Learning how to analyze and interpret large datasets in biomedicine, with a focus on using AI and machine learning techniques.
โข Ethics and Regulations in AI for Biomedicine: Examining the ethical and regulatory issues surrounding the use of AI in biomedicine, including data privacy, security, and bias.
โข Designing Smart Biomedical Devices: Understanding how to design and develop smart biomedical devices that incorporate AI and machine learning technologies.
โข AI-Powered Diagnostics: Exploring the use of AI in medical diagnostics, including image analysis, natural language processing, and other techniques.
โข AI-Driven Drug Discovery: Learning how AI can be used to accelerate drug discovery and development, with a focus on biomedical applications.
โข AI for Personalized Medicine: Examining the role of AI in personalized medicine, including the use of genomic data and other biomarkers to tailor treatments to individual patients.
โข AI in Clinical Trials: Understanding how AI can be used to improve the design, execution, and analysis of clinical trials in biomedicine.
โข Future Directions in AI for Biomedicine: Exploring the latest trends and developments in AI for biomedicine, including emerging technologies and applications.
